Configure the Input Flow Record You can create a flow record and add keys to match on and fields to collect in the flow. config terminal flow record … WebOct 27, 2024 · NetFlow operates on a stateful basis. When a client machine reaches out to a server, NetFlow will begin capturing and aggregating metadata from the flow. After the session is terminated, NetFlow will export a single complete record to the collector. Though it’s still commonly used, NetFlow v5 has a number of limitations. shards python

WebDec 15, 2024 · Under Work Centers > Profiler > Endpoint Classification, ... Cisco NetFlow is a form of telemetry exported from Cisco IOS Software-based routers and Layer 3 switches. NetFlow provides information about traffic passing through or directly to each NetFlow-enabled router or switch.
